FLUXTON STW is a wastewater treatment plant located in Fluxton, near Ottery St. Mary in East Devon, England. It serves a population of approximately 4,686 people, classifying it as a small agglomeration under UK water industry standards. The plant is situated inland, within 50 km of the coast, and discharges into the local river system. As a UK wastewater facility, FLUXTON STW operates under the Water Industry Act 1991 and is regulated by the Environment Agency. For a plant of this scale, secondary treatment is typically required, with additional nutrient removal if discharging into sensitive areas. The designed capacity is 1.00 (likely in megalitres per day or similar units), indicating the plant's treatment capability. The plant's treated effluent likely discharges into the River Otter, which flows south through East Devon and enters the English Channel at Budleigh Salterton. The river supports diverse aquatic life, including salmon and trout, and its estuary is an important habitat for birds. The plant plays a key role in protecting water quality in this ecologically sensitive coastal catchment.
